Transaction 70e42e13b906bc5667e5804785d56244236fe90eab1492277fa5a6ffdab448be

4 Input
1 Outputs
  • 70e42e13b906bc5667e5804785d56244236fe90eab1492277fa5a6ffdab448be:0
  • value  6757859
    address  3DqHMoDGMbjfrdJUjG59BXP4FbGg41uHEH